SBU exposes military man on spying on trains to Kherson and Mykolaiv

(PHOTO: uz.gov.ua)

The SBU detained a serviceman who was in the AFU for high treason. He was passing data on the movement of railway transport and cargo in the direction of Kherson and Mykolaiv to Russian special services.

This is evidenced by the decision of the Central District Court of Mykolaiv.

The Security Service of Ukraine is conducting a pre-trial investigation in a criminal proceeding on the grounds of high treason. According to the investigation, after the introduction of martial law in Ukraine, that is, from February 24, 2022, the man provided a representative of the aggressor country with information on the movement of railway transport and cargo in the direction of Kherson and Mykolaiv via the Telegram messenger.

The investigation revealed that the man received tasks and instructions from a representative of the Russian special service. He agreed to carry out the task, realizing that it could result in strikes on railroad transport, damage to infrastructure and loss of life.

In early March 2026, the suspect, near the Novopetrivka railway station, installed a hidden online camera on a tree trunk near the railway tracks. The camera had a SIM card of the Vodafone mobile operator and a 64 GB memory card and provided remote access to a Russian representative to monitor the movement of trains and cargo.

In early March, in the evening, the suspect was detained by law enforcement officers and notified of being suspected of treason.

At the court hearing, the suspect admitted that he had committed the actions he was charged with. He explained that he was a military serviceman, but left his place of service without permission. To earn money, he began to communicate with a representative of the Russian Federation and, on his instructions, bought cameras that he installed near the railroad tracks to monitor the movement of freight trains.

His defense lawyer requested that the suspect be placed under round-the-clock house arrest. The court imposed a pre-trial restraint in the form of detention until May 3, 2026 inclusive.

The court also extended the arrest of the former dispatcher of the humanitarian headquarters of the Novokakhovka MVA on charges of treason. He is suspected of passing intelligence on the location of the Ukrainian military to the enemy.
